Default Deerfoot Southbound Closed (May 31- PM)

http://www.am770chqr.com/news/news_l...news_local.cfm
Quote:
CALGARY/AM770CHQR - Due to a gasoline tanker truck that has major leak, southbound Deerfoot Trail is closed at 17 Ave SE and traffic will be diverted east and west at that point.
The tanker ran over a large piece of wood on Deerfoot which resulted in a puncture in the tank.
This closure will be in effect until the clean-up is complete.
It is anticipated this will be cleaned up at approximately 6pm.
